Output 8b7542e9d7411f5942ea6a16b0c7f0c690f29cf6cbb406bb2e2a76bb0060f5f9:0

value
10023947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c8ba1ac0364c1501bf7bca7fb059ccb91293e4 OP_EQUAL
address
3NBZkGWTXy67MAATzSZWQsryUMYMqzzcgE
transaction
8b7542e9d7411f5942ea6a16b0c7f0c690f29cf6cbb406bb2e2a76bb0060f5f9
spent
true